Step-by-step explanation:
We arrange the number as -3, 1, 7, 8, 18, 19, 42, the old median is 8.
But the median has change to 11 when the number is add, which means that the number is between 7 and 18.
(8 + x)/2 = 11 Where x is the new number
8 + x = 22
x = 14
